Neuroinflammatory
disorders, such as multiple sclerosis or experimental
autoimmune encephalomyelitis (EAE), an established mouse model mimicking
part of the human pathology, are characterized by inflammatory infiltrates
containing T helper 1 (TH1) and TH17 cells,
which cause demyelination and neurodegeneration. Disease onset and
perpetuation are mediated by peripherally generated autoreactive T
cells infiltrating into the central nervous system, where they are
restimulated by antigen-presenting cells. Here, we show that newly
designed peripherally active, potent, and selective κ-opioid
receptor (KOR) agonists comprising the ethylenediamine KOR pharmacophore
in a perhydroquinoxaline scaffold exhibit potent anti-inflammatory
capacities in primary antigen presenting cells as well as T cells.
In the EAE model, the secondary amine 12 and the triazole 14 were able to ameliorate disease severity and to delay disease
onset by blocking effector T cell activation. Importantly, the beneficial
effects were mediated via signaling through KOR because off-target
effects were excluded by using KOR-deficient mouse mutants.
